Tony Khan Paid For Mark Davis Surgery, Despite Not Being Signed To AEW

Hamish Woodward

Tony Khan announced that Mark Davis and Kyle Fletcher are All Elite, as Aussie Open signed with AEW after this week’s AEW Dynamite.

This came after Kyle Fletcher fell short in his attempt to take the AEW International Championship from Orange Cassidy, getting rolled up by the champion in disappointing defeat.

However, Mark Davis was not in attendance, as he is currently recovering from a meniscus surgery that cost Aussie Open their NJPW Tag Team titles.

However, even before they were signed to AEW, Tony Khan paid for Mark Davis surgery, as simply a gesture of goodwill toward the Australian star.

This act clearly made an impact on the group, and surely was part of the reason they left NJPW to sign for AEW full-time.

On Twitter, Sean Ross Sapp confirmed this story, Tweeting out;

“An interesting note from our Fightful Select story — Tony Khan paid for Mark Davis’ meniscus surgery himself while Aussie Open weren’t under contract. Pretty cool gesture”

It is unknown how long Mark Davis will be out for, but once he recovers from his injury, Aussie Open will be on track to become AEW Tag Team Champions.

Their signing also increases the odds of Will Ospreay signing with AEW, as he currently teams with the duo as part of his United Empire faction in NJPW.
